So I wrote an entire entry yesterday, but the power shut off and I lost it. Anyway, I am reporting from Koh Phangam, a small island off the southern coast. I flew into Bangkok on Monday. I instantly realized that Thailand is much much different from Cambodia. Bangkok is an enormous super metropolis with skyscapers everywhere, hoards of people, and lots and lots of hookers. I stayed a a guest house on Soi 1, a couple of blocks away from Sukhumvit Rd. Sukhumvit is one of the major streets in the city with hotels, Mcdonalds, and thousands of prositutes inundating the sidewalk. I have never seen anything like it before. On my first day in town, I met a girl from London and she and I did the typical toursity things. We took every type of transportation imaginable (taxi, boat, metro, walking) and visited some major temples, China town , the Indian sector, the Western sector, and the unbelievable shopping mall with about 7 stories and a neverending food court.

I soon realized that I had not planned my vacation for long enough. I decided to extend my stay for an extra 4 days to beach bounce along the southern coast. I am travelling with the beforementioned British girl and we started our trip with an overnight train and ferry to Koh Phangam (where I am now). This island is like a paradise. We got a really inexpensive bungalow right on the beach, the food is really cheap, and it is nice to stay clear of the hustle and bustle of Bangkok. Last night we went to an infamous Black Moon party of the beach, which is essentially an all night techno rave. I don't think I went to bed until 6:30 or 7 am. Tomorrow we leave for a beach called Phuket, then back to Cambodia on Wednesday.
